Hey Migsy,
I think your mate may have been referring to the way the RBA lists the production run on their web site.

Check it out at http://www.rba.gov.au/banknotes/col...9/index.html

I think my note is in pretty good condition with no major creases nor pin holes but its way off being uncirculated unfortunately.

IMHO I would advise against selling your note, unless you really need the coin, as it's bound to increase in value. As time goes by its rarity is certainly going to increase.

I've been noodling notes for a fair while now (although I did have a break for 2 months or so) and haven't seen any other notes that come close to ours, so hang in there as long as you can before selling. I noodled at least 60K in 50's before I found mine. With odds of 1 in 192,471 notes I think we are very lucky.

With a serial DL 99 889922 "99" being the year...its not a radar bcoz you would have to have a number like 889988 or 229922 to be a radar.If it is Unc then being an older note it might be worth a little more...then again I aint NO expert!

Pays to check the RBAs website for first and Last prefixes...keep an eye out for them.
